RF Accessories, also known as Radio Frequency Accessories, are integrated circuit products used in RF systems to process high-frequency signals. These accessories mainly include key components such as power amplifiers (PA), mixers, filters, switches, attenuators, etc. In terms of design principle, RF accessories achieve functions such as amplification, conversion, and filtering of RF signals through the combination of core components such as transistors, inductors, capacitors, and resonant cavities, to ensure efficient transmission and reception of signals in wireless communication systems. RF accessories require precise design and manufacturing processes to ensure excellent performance over a wide frequency range, while meeting key indicators such as noise figure, gain, and linearity.
Application
RF Accessories have a wide range of applications in wireless communication systems, radar systems, satellite communications, broadcast systems, wireless local area network (WLAN) and Bluetooth technology. In the field of mobile communications, RF accessories are a key component of mobile phone base stations and mobile terminals for the transmission and reception of signals. In radar and military communications, high-performance RF accessories can improve the detection range and anti-interference capability of the system. In addition, RF accessories are also used in smart homes, Internet of Things (IoT) devices, automotive communication systems and other scenarios, supporting short-range communication protocols such as Wi-Fi and Zigbee. With the development of 5G technology and millimeter wave communication, the increasing demand for high-performance RF accessories has driven the advancement and innovation of related technologies.
